Annual Temperature and Precipitation Patterns in Aggtelek National Park

Average monthly mean temperatures range from a low of -3.99 degrees Celsius in January up to 20.49 degrees Celsius in July, with average minimums sinking to -14.65 degrees Celsius in winter. Average daily precipitation peaks at 2.85 millimeters in July alongside warmer temperatures, mapped from long-term climatology for the Aggtelek region at a representative elevation of 338.38 meters.

Complete Monthly Climate Normals and Weather by Month for Aggtelek National Park

Aggtelek National Park monthly profiles trace the annual variations in average temperatures, daily precipitation rates, and relative humidity using 1991 to 2020 baseline climatology. Comparing calculated average daylight hours and typical wind speeds alongside temperature thresholds offers a detailed baseline of the regional environmental patterns.
Mean temperaturePrecipitationHumidityWind speedDaylight
January-4 °C-14.7° to 5°1.1 mm/day91.7%2.8 m/s8.6 hours
February-1.9 °C-12.5° to 9.2°1.3 mm/day87.2%3 m/s9.9 hours
March3.1 °C-7.5° to 16.8°1.2 mm/day77.6%3.2 m/s11.6 hours
April9.4 °C-3.1° to 22.4°1.7 mm/day71.3%2.9 m/s13.5 hours
May14.7 °C2.7° to 26.4°2.4 mm/day70.3%2.7 m/s15 hours
June18.5 °C7.3° to 30.1°2.7 mm/day69.3%2.5 m/s15.8 hours
July20.5 °C9.3° to 32.3°2.9 mm/day66.4%2.4 m/s15.5 hours
August20.3 °C8.9° to 32°2.1 mm/day64.5%2.3 m/s14.1 hours
September14.8 °C4° to 27.1°1.9 mm/day70%2.5 m/s12.3 hours
October8.8 °C-2.6° to 22.1°1.8 mm/day79.4%2.5 m/s10.5 hours
November3 °C-6.4° to 14.9°1.7 mm/day88.3%2.5 m/s8.9 hours
December-2.6 °C-12.3° to 6°1.4 mm/day91.7%2.5 m/s8.2 hours
